Every day, the moderator of one of our mailman lists receives a message
telling him  that his mailing list "has 2 request(s) waiting for your
consideration at:

        http://..../mailman/admindb/maillist_name
        
Please attend to this at your earliest convenience.  This notice of pending
requests, if any, will be sent out daily.


Pending posts:
From: [EMAIL PROTECTED] on Mon Aug 22 08:51:59 2005
Subject: 100's of titles by MS 2003 MS 2003 & Windows starting @ 9.99
Cause: Post by non-member to a members-only list
"


But, in the maillist administration page there are no pending posts.

As I am the system manger, where can I look for such "phantom" posts in
order to delete them ?

I am using Mailman 2.1.5
